Cervantes, Linwood win “Tiger Takeover” event

Linden-Kildare High School chefs competed in the pilot program called the “Tiger Takeover” for an opportunity to have their creation on the school menu on Nov. 4.L-K Culinary Arts students began planning and practicing recipes in September for the honor and the winners would get to work with the cafeteria ...
